CBRL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

316 of the 6,340 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Cracker Barrel (CBRL)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$2.24B — down 7.5% from $2.43B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 50 funds closed out of CBRL and 48 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 96 trimmed existing stakes and 108 added.

The largest buyer was Bank of America, adding an estimated $38.3M. The largest seller was Palisade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$11.4M sold.
